This is the first time we have been here in the fall. We usually come down here in May with the Rally on the Rocks event (www.rallyontherocks.com). A must do for all those who like to ride. During this event you can pick the trails you want to do and then you are taken out with a guide (now these guides donate their time and know the area). This is a great way to learn the trails. All the assistance you would need on the trail is already there for you.
